Odroid XU4 benchmark EMMC module VS Sdcard against Compiler optimization Odroid XU4 ArchLinux LLVM 7.0.1 Aggressive flags Odroid XU4 Ubuntu 18.04 GCC 7.3 Stock: Processor: ARMv7 rev 3 @ 1.50GHz (8 Cores), Motherboard: ODROID-XU4 Hardkernel Odroid XU4, Memory: 2048MB, Disk: 16GB SDW16G + 64GB SP64G OS: Ubuntu 18.04, Kernel: 4.14.87-153 (armv7l), Display Server: X Server 1.19.6, OpenCL: OpenCL 1.2 v1.r12p0-04rel0.03af15950392f3702b248717f4938b82, Compiler: GCC 7.3.0 + Clang 6.0.0-1ubuntu2 + LLVM 6.0.0, File-System: ext4 Odroid XU4 ArchLinux GCC 8.2 Stock: Processor: ARMv7 rev 3 @ 1.50GHz (8 Cores), Motherboard: ODROID-XU4 Hardkernel Odroid XU4, Memory: 2048MB, Disk: 16GB SDW16G + 64GB SP64G OS: Arch Linux ARM, Kernel: 4.14.87-1-ARCH (armv7l), Display Server: X Server 1.20.3, Compiler: GCC 8.2.0 + Clang 7.0.0 + LLVM 7.0.0, File-System: ext4 Odroid XU4 Ubuntu 18.04 LLVM 6 Stock: Processor: ARMv7 rev 3 @ 1.50GHz (8 Cores), Motherboard: ODROID-XU4 Hardkernel Odroid XU4, Memory: 2048MB, Disk: 16GB SDW16G + 64GB SP64G OS: Ubuntu 18.04, Kernel: 4.14.87-153 (armv7l), Display Server: X Server 1.19.6, OpenCL: OpenCL 1.2 v1.r12p0-04rel0.03af15950392f3702b248717f4938b82, Compiler: Clang 6.0.0-1ubuntu2 + GCC 7.3.0 + LLVM 6.0.0, File-System: ext4 Odroid XU4 ArchLinux LLVM 7.0.1 Stock: Processor: ARMv7 rev 3 @ 1.50GHz (8 Cores), Motherboard: ODROID-XU4 Hardkernel Odroid XU4, Memory: 2048MB, Disk: 16GB SDW16G + 64GB SP64G OS: Arch Linux ARM, Kernel: 4.14.87-1-ARCH (armv7l), Display Server: X Server 1.20.3, Compiler: Clang 7.0.1 + GCC 8.2.0 + LLVM 7.0.1, File-System: ext4 Odroid XU4 ArchLinux LLVM 7.0.1 -O3: Processor: ARMv7 rev 3 @ 1.50GHz (8 Cores), Motherboard: ODROID-XU4 Hardkernel Odroid XU4, Memory: 2048MB, Disk: 16GB SDW16G + 64GB SP64G OS: Arch Linux ARM, Kernel: 4.14.87-1-ARCH (armv7l), Display Server: X Server 1.20.3, Compiler: Clang 7.0.1 + GCC 8.2.0 + LLVM 7.0.1, File-System: ext4 Odroid XU4 ArchLinux GCC 8.2 -O3: Processor: ARMv7 rev 3 @ 1.50GHz (8 Cores), Motherboard: ODROID-XU4 Hardkernel Odroid XU4, Memory: 2048MB, Disk: 16GB SDW16G + 64GB SP64G OS: Arch Linux ARM, Kernel: 4.14.87-1-ARCH (armv7l), Display Server: X Server 1.20.3, Compiler: GCC 8.2.0 + Clang 7.0.1 + LLVM 7.0.1, File-System: ext4 Odroid XU4 ArchLinux GCC 8.2 Aggressive flags: Processor: ARMv7 rev 3 @ 1.50GHz (8 Cores), Motherboard: ODROID-XU4 Hardkernel Odroid XU4, Memory: 2048MB, Disk: 16GB SDW16G + 64GB SP64G OS: Arch Linux ARM, Kernel: 4.14.87-1-ARCH (armv7l), Display Server: X Server 1.20.3, Compiler: GCC 8.2.0 + Clang 7.0.1 + LLVM 7.0.1, File-System: ext4 Odroid XU4 ArchLinux LLVM 7.0.1 Aggressive flags: Processor: ARMv7 rev 3 @ 1.50GHz (8 Cores), Motherboard: ODROID-XU4 Hardkernel Odroid XU4, Memory: 2048MB, Disk: 16GB SDW16G + 64GB SP64G OS: Arch Linux ARM, Kernel: 4.14.87-1-ARCH (armv7l), Display Server: X Server 1.20.3, Compiler: Clang 7.0.1 + GCC 8.2.0 + LLVM 7.0.1, File-System: ext4 Tinymembench 2018-05-28 Standard Memcpy MB/s > Higher Is Better Odroid XU4 Ubuntu 18.04 GCC 7.3 Stock ......... 1430 |============= Odroid XU4 ArchLinux GCC 8.2 Stock ............ 2746 |========================= Odroid XU4 ArchLinux GCC 8.2 -O3 .............. 2696 |========================= Odroid XU4 ArchLinux GCC 8.2 Aggressive flags . 2702 |========================= Tinymembench 2018-05-28 Standard Memset MB/s > Higher Is Better Odroid XU4 Ubuntu 18.04 GCC 7.3 Stock ......... 4566 |======================= Odroid XU4 ArchLinux GCC 8.2 Stock ............ 4904 |========================= Odroid XU4 ArchLinux GCC 8.2 -O3 .............. 4913 |========================= Odroid XU4 ArchLinux GCC 8.2 Aggressive flags . 4915 |========================= Timed MAFFT Alignment 7.392 Multiple Sequence Alignment Seconds < Lower Is Better Odroid XU4 Ubuntu 18.04 GCC 7.3 Stock ............ 20.45 |================== Odroid XU4 ArchLinux GCC 8.2 Stock ............... 19.26 |================= Odroid XU4 Ubuntu 18.04 LLVM 6 Stock ............. 24.26 |===================== Odroid XU4 ArchLinux LLVM 7.0.1 Stock ............ 21.99 |=================== Odroid XU4 ArchLinux LLVM 7.0.1 -O3 .............. 22.55 |==================== Odroid XU4 ArchLinux GCC 8.2 -O3 ................. 20.94 |================== Odroid XU4 ArchLinux GCC 8.2 Aggressive flags .... 20.17 |================= Odroid XU4 ArchLinux LLVM 7.0.1 Aggressive flags . 20.17 |================= SciMark 2.0 Computational Test: Composite Mflops > Higher Is Better Odroid XU4 Ubuntu 18.04 GCC 7.3 Stock ......... 263 |====================== Odroid XU4 ArchLinux GCC 8.2 Stock ............ 141 |============ Odroid XU4 Ubuntu 18.04 LLVM 6 Stock .......... 139 |============ Odroid XU4 ArchLinux LLVM 7.0.1 Stock ......... 156 |============= Odroid XU4 ArchLinux LLVM 7.0.1 -O3 ........... 290 |======================== Odroid XU4 ArchLinux GCC 8.2 -O3 .............. 292 |======================== Odroid XU4 ArchLinux GCC 8.2 Aggressive flags . 314 |========================== TSCP 1.81 AI Chess Performance Nodes Per Second > Higher Is Better Odroid XU4 Ubuntu 18.04 GCC 7.3 Stock ......... 310305 |======================= Odroid XU4 ArchLinux GCC 8.2 Stock ............ 301604 |====================== Odroid XU4 ArchLinux GCC 8.2 -O3 .............. 301038 |====================== Odroid XU4 ArchLinux GCC 8.2 Aggressive flags . 306398 |======================= x264 2018-09-25 H.264 Video Encoding Frames Per Second > Higher Is Better Odroid XU4 Ubuntu 18.04 GCC 7.3 Stock ......... 5.06 |======================== Odroid XU4 ArchLinux GCC 8.2 Stock ............ 5.26 |========================= Odroid XU4 Ubuntu 18.04 LLVM 6 Stock .......... 4.79 |======================= Odroid XU4 ArchLinux LLVM 7.0.1 Stock ......... 5.09 |======================== Odroid XU4 ArchLinux LLVM 7.0.1 -O3 ........... 4.98 |======================== Odroid XU4 ArchLinux GCC 8.2 -O3 .............. 5.19 |========================= Odroid XU4 ArchLinux GCC 8.2 Aggressive flags . 5.24 |========================= 7-Zip Compression 16.02 Compress Speed Test MIPS > Higher Is Better Odroid XU4 Ubuntu 18.04 GCC 7.3 Stock ......... 4734 |========================= Odroid XU4 ArchLinux GCC 8.2 Stock ............ 4572 |======================== Odroid XU4 ArchLinux GCC 8.2 -O3 .............. 4583 |======================== Odroid XU4 ArchLinux GCC 8.2 Aggressive flags . 4573 |======================== AOBench Size: 2048 x 2048 - Total Time Seconds < Lower Is Better Odroid XU4 Ubuntu 18.04 GCC 7.3 Stock ......... 150 |===================== Odroid XU4 ArchLinux GCC 8.2 Stock ............ 120 |================= Odroid XU4 Ubuntu 18.04 LLVM 6 Stock .......... 184 |========================== Odroid XU4 ArchLinux LLVM 7.0.1 Stock ......... 146 |===================== Odroid XU4 ArchLinux LLVM 7.0.1 -O3 ........... 146 |===================== Odroid XU4 ArchLinux GCC 8.2 -O3 .............. 120 |================= Odroid XU4 ArchLinux GCC 8.2 Aggressive flags . 120 |================= dcraw RAW To PPM Image Conversion Seconds < Lower Is Better Odroid XU4 Ubuntu 18.04 GCC 7.3 Stock ......... 65.62 |======= Odroid XU4 ArchLinux GCC 8.2 Stock ............ 208.75 |======================= Odroid XU4 Ubuntu 18.04 LLVM 6 Stock .......... 179.87 |==================== Odroid XU4 ArchLinux LLVM 7.0.1 Stock ......... 171.42 |=================== Odroid XU4 ArchLinux LLVM 7.0.1 -O3 ........... 67.75 |======= Odroid XU4 ArchLinux GCC 8.2 -O3 .............. 66.42 |======= Odroid XU4 ArchLinux GCC 8.2 Aggressive flags . 63.42 |======= LAME MP3 Encoding 3.100 WAV To MP3 Seconds < Lower Is Better Odroid XU4 Ubuntu 18.04 GCC 7.3 Stock ......... 41.24 |========= Odroid XU4 ArchLinux GCC 8.2 Stock ............ 111.11 |======================= Odroid XU4 Ubuntu 18.04 LLVM 6 Stock .......... 40.92 |======== Odroid XU4 ArchLinux LLVM 7.0.1 Stock ......... 47.52 |========== Odroid XU4 ArchLinux LLVM 7.0.1 -O3 ........... 47.56 |========== Odroid XU4 ArchLinux GCC 8.2 -O3 .............. 41.88 |========= Odroid XU4 ArchLinux GCC 8.2 Aggressive flags . 39.77 |======== Perl Benchmarks Test: Pod2html Seconds < Lower Is Better Odroid XU4 Ubuntu 18.04 GCC 7.3 Stock ............ 0.59712871 |=============== Odroid XU4 ArchLinux GCC 8.2 Stock ............... 0.64551075 |================ Odroid XU4 Ubuntu 18.04 LLVM 6 Stock ............. 0.59936505 |=============== Odroid XU4 ArchLinux LLVM 7.0.1 Stock ............ 0.64712824 |================ Odroid XU4 ArchLinux LLVM 7.0.1 -O3 .............. 0.64752994 |================ Odroid XU4 ArchLinux GCC 8.2 -O3 ................. 0.64667046 |================ Odroid XU4 ArchLinux GCC 8.2 Aggressive flags .... 0.64418411 |================ Odroid XU4 ArchLinux LLVM 7.0.1 Aggressive flags . 0.64635704 |================ Perl Benchmarks Test: Interpreter Seconds < Lower Is Better Odroid XU4 Ubuntu 18.04 GCC 7.3 Stock ............ 0.00750962 |=============== Odroid XU4 ArchLinux GCC 8.2 Stock ............... 0.00622282 |============= Odroid XU4 Ubuntu 18.04 LLVM 6 Stock ............. 0.00787012 |================ Odroid XU4 ArchLinux LLVM 7.0.1 Stock ............ 0.00618222 |============= Odroid XU4 ArchLinux LLVM 7.0.1 -O3 .............. 0.00628384 |============= Odroid XU4 ArchLinux GCC 8.2 -O3 ................. 0.00621844 |============= Odroid XU4 ArchLinux GCC 8.2 Aggressive flags .... 0.00615616 |============= Odroid XU4 ArchLinux LLVM 7.0.1 Aggressive flags . 0.00616805 |============= Sudokut 0.4 Total Time Seconds < Lower Is Better Odroid XU4 Ubuntu 18.04 GCC 7.3 Stock ............ 57.89 |================== Odroid XU4 ArchLinux GCC 8.2 Stock ............... 66.37 |===================== Odroid XU4 Ubuntu 18.04 LLVM 6 Stock ............. 59.36 |=================== Odroid XU4 ArchLinux LLVM 7.0.1 Stock ............ 66.34 |===================== Odroid XU4 ArchLinux LLVM 7.0.1 -O3 .............. 66.35 |===================== Odroid XU4 ArchLinux GCC 8.2 -O3 ................. 66.36 |===================== Odroid XU4 ArchLinux GCC 8.2 Aggressive flags .... 66.37 |===================== Odroid XU4 ArchLinux LLVM 7.0.1 Aggressive flags . 66.37 |===================== PyBench 2018-02-16 Total For Average Test Times Milliseconds < Lower Is Better Odroid XU4 Ubuntu 18.04 GCC 7.3 Stock ............ 4877 |=============== Odroid XU4 ArchLinux GCC 8.2 Stock ............... 7319 |====================== Odroid XU4 Ubuntu 18.04 LLVM 6 Stock ............. 4920 |=============== Odroid XU4 ArchLinux LLVM 7.0.1 Stock ............ 7264 |====================== Odroid XU4 ArchLinux LLVM 7.0.1 -O3 .............. 7339 |====================== Odroid XU4 ArchLinux GCC 8.2 -O3 ................. 7307 |====================== Odroid XU4 ArchLinux GCC 8.2 Aggressive flags .... 7330 |====================== Odroid XU4 ArchLinux LLVM 7.0.1 Aggressive flags . 7336 |====================== PHPBench 0.8.1 PHP Benchmark Suite Score > Higher Is Better Odroid XU4 Ubuntu 18.04 GCC 7.3 Stock ............ 94315 |==================== Odroid XU4 ArchLinux GCC 8.2 Stock ............... 92584 |==================== Odroid XU4 Ubuntu 18.04 LLVM 6 Stock ............. 92468 |==================== Odroid XU4 ArchLinux LLVM 7.0.1 Stock ............ 91371 |==================== Odroid XU4 ArchLinux LLVM 7.0.1 -O3 .............. 98051 |===================== Odroid XU4 ArchLinux GCC 8.2 -O3 ................. 96071 |===================== Odroid XU4 ArchLinux GCC 8.2 Aggressive flags .... 93383 |==================== Odroid XU4 ArchLinux LLVM 7.0.1 Aggressive flags . 95549 |==================== Git Time To Complete Common Git Commands Seconds < Lower Is Better Odroid XU4 Ubuntu 18.04 GCC 7.3 Stock ............ 28.03 |==================== Odroid XU4 ArchLinux GCC 8.2 Stock ............... 23.37 |================= Odroid XU4 Ubuntu 18.04 LLVM 6 Stock ............. 29.73 |===================== Odroid XU4 ArchLinux LLVM 7.0.1 Stock ............ 24.04 |================= Odroid XU4 ArchLinux LLVM 7.0.1 -O3 .............. 23.79 |================= Odroid XU4 ArchLinux GCC 8.2 -O3 ................. 23.29 |================ Odroid XU4 ArchLinux GCC 8.2 Aggressive flags .... 23.38 |================= Odroid XU4 ArchLinux LLVM 7.0.1 Aggressive flags . 23.48 |=================